
Zamir Kabulov
Zamir Kabulov is the Special Representative of the President of Russia for Afghanistan, playing a crucial role in diplomatic efforts concerning the Taliban and the situation in Afghanistan. He has indicated that a high-level decision has been made regarding the possible removal of the Taliban from the list of terrorist organizations, although he noted that necessary legal steps must still be completed.
